                In Figure 8-34, a 1.2 kg block is held at rest against a spring with a force constant k = 785 N/m. Initially, the spring is compressed a distance d. When the block is released, it slides across a surface that is frictionless, except for a rough patch of width 5.0 cm that has a coefficient of kinetic friction µk = 0.44. Find d such that the block's speed after crossing the rough patch is 2.0 m/s.
